Anchoring a trampoline is important for making certain the security of customers and stopping harm to the trampoline or surrounding property. By securely anchoring the trampoline, you’ll be able to reduce the chance of it overturning or transferring in excessive winds or different adversarial climate situations.
There are a number of other ways to anchor a trampoline, however the perfect methodology will rely on the particular trampoline mannequin and the kind of floor the place will probably be put in. Usually, there are three fundamental varieties of anchoring techniques for trampolines: in-ground anchors, floor stakes, and weight baggage.
In-ground anchors are essentially the most safe sort of anchoring system and are really useful for trampolines that shall be used often or in areas with excessive winds. Floor stakes are a much less everlasting anchoring resolution and are finest fitted to trampolines that shall be used sometimes or in areas with average winds. Weight baggage are the least safe sort of anchoring system and are solely really useful for trampolines that shall be used sometimes or in areas with very low winds.
Regardless of which anchoring system you select, it is very important observe the producer’s directions fastidiously to make sure that the trampoline is correctly secured.

Ideas for Anchoring a Trampoline
Guaranteeing the soundness and security of your trampoline requires correct anchoring. Listed below are some important tricks to information you thru the method:
Tip 1: Select the Proper Anchoring System
Choose an anchoring system that aligns together with your trampoline’s dimension, weight, and the bottom situations. In-ground anchors supply most safety, whereas floor stakes and weight baggage present various ranges of stability relying on the particular trampoline and floor sort.
Tip 2: Decide the Variety of Anchors
The variety of anchors required will depend on the trampoline’s dimension and the anchoring system used. Bigger trampolines and softer floor situations usually necessitate extra anchors for optimum stability.
Tip 3: Observe Producer’s Directions
Every anchoring system comes with particular set up tips. Rigorously observe the producer’s directions to make sure correct set up and the security of your trampoline.
Tip 4: Dig Deep Holes for In-Floor Anchors
When utilizing in-ground anchors, dig holes which are a minimum of 2 toes deep and vast sufficient to accommodate the anchors securely. This depth ensures stability and prevents the anchors from pulling out of the bottom.
Tip 5: Use Excessive-High quality Anchors and {Hardware}
Spend money on sturdy anchors and {hardware} produced from galvanized metal or different corrosion-resistant supplies. This ensures longevity and reliability, stopping untimely failure or rusting.
Tip 6: Examine Anchors Often
Periodically examine the anchors and {hardware} for any indicators of harm or put on. Tighten unfastened bolts or change broken elements promptly to keep up the trampoline’s stability and security.
Tip 7: Take into account Extra Security Measures
Along with anchoring, think about using a security internet and padding across the trampoline. These measures present additional safety for customers and reduce the chance of accidents.
By following the following pointers, you’ll be able to successfully anchor your trampoline, making certain a steady and protected setting for pleasurable and worry-free use.
